Detects pockets of insect infestation. The procedure takes up to 10 minutes.<\/p>\n<p>Then the <a href=\"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/disinfestation\/\">disinfestation<\/a> process begins. A specialist selects a concentrate and dilutes it in water. After that, he overturns furniture and objects that the owners of the flats had moved out of the way beforehand.<\/p>\n<p>He treats surfaces with the solution obtained: walls, floors (carpet, linoleum, parquet, laminate), skirting boards, various surfaces, ventilation, upholstered furniture, doors and windows, niches and more.<\/p>\n<p>The procedure takes up to an hour and a half, depending on the size of the room and the number of rooms.<\/p>\n<p>Once the treatment has been completed, a contract is drawn up. Signed by both parties. If the customer has any questions, the specialist will provide competent and detailed answers and then the process is completed.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): The Bed Bug Treatment Process<\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ong>1. Where does the bed bug treatment procedure by a Eurodez specialist begin?<\/strong> Before starting the disinfection, the specialist performs a thorough inspection of the premises. This is necessary to assess the degree of infestation, identify the main breeding grounds of the parasites, and select the most effective method of treatment.<\/p>\n<p><strong>2. What disinfection technologies do you use?<\/strong> We apply professional &#8220;cold&#8221; and &#8220;hot&#8221; <a href=\"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/fumigation\/\">fog<\/a> methods. The insecticide solution is transformed into a fine mist that penetrates the smallest cracks, furniture joints, and hard-to-reach places where bed bugs usually hide.<\/p>\n<p><strong>3. How should I properly prepare the room before the exterminator arrives?<\/strong> You need to move furniture away from the walls (by 20\u201330 cm), store food and dishes in closed cabinets, and remove bed linen and textiles for subsequent washing at a high temperature. It is also important to ensure free access to baseboards and room corners.<\/p>\n<p><strong>4. Do I need to remove pets from the house?<\/strong> Yes, during the work, neither people nor pets should be in the premises. You can return to the apartment only after the procedure is completed and the required airing time has passed.<\/p>\n<p><strong>5. Are the preparations you use safe?<\/strong> All work is carried out using certified insecticides. They are effective against insects but, provided the recommendations of our specialists regarding ventilation and wet cleaning are followed, they remain safe for the health of the occupants.<\/p>\n<p><strong>6. How long does the treatment process take?<\/strong> On average, the procedure lasts from one to two hours. The exact duration depends on the area of the object, the degree of infestation, and the chosen disinfection method.<\/p>\n<p><strong>7. How soon does the effect of the treatment appear?<\/strong> The first results are noticeable within a day. Complete extermination of the colony may take up to 14 days \u2014 this is due to the peculiarities of the insect life cycle and the action time of the preparations.<\/p>\n<p><strong>8. Do I need to be present during the process?<\/strong> Usually, residents leave the premises during the treatment. If you want to be present during the work, you must use a professional respirator to protect your respiratory system.<\/p>\n<p><strong>9. What should be done with furniture if bed bugs live in it?<\/strong> Our specialists carefully treat upholstered furniture, sofas (in disassembled form), and mattresses. Modern preparations allow for the extermination of parasites even in the deep layers of upholstery and internal structures.<\/p>\n<p><strong>10. Are there any stains or odors left after disinfection?<\/strong> The professional products used at Eurodez are selected in such a way as to minimize aesthetic discomfort. Once the room has been ventilated in accordance with the instructions, unpleasant odors quickly dissipate, and marks on furniture and walls are generally absent.[\/vc_column_text][\/vc_column][vc_column width=&#8221;1\/6&#8243;][\/vc_column][\/vc_row]<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>[vc_row woodmart_css_id=&#8221;62f63beec32c4&#8243; responsive_spacing=&#8221;eyJwYXJhbV90eXBlIjoid29vZG1hcnRfcmVzcG9uc2l2ZV9zcGFjaW5nIiwic2VsZWN0b3JfaWQiOiI2MmY2M2JlZWMzMmM0Iiwic2hvcnRjb2RlIjoidmNfcm93IiwiZGF0YSI6eyJ0YWJsZXQiOnt9LCJtb2JpbGUiOnt9fX0=&#8221; mobile_bg_img_hidden=&#8221;no&#8221; tablet_bg_img_hidden=&#8221;no&#8221; woodmart_parallax=&#8221;0&#8243; woodmart_gradient_switch=&#8221;no&#8221; woodmart_box_shadow=&#8221;no&#8221; wd_z_index=&#8221;no&#8221; woodmart_disable_overflow=&#8221;0&#8243; row_reverse_mobile=&#8221;0&#8243; row_reverse_tablet=&#8221;0&#8243;][vc_column width=&#8221;1\/6&#8243;][\/vc_column][vc_column width=&#8221;2\/3&#8243;][vc_column_text woodmart_inline=&#8221;no&#8221; text_larger=&#8221;no&#8221;]The specialist must have dressed<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":3,"featured_media":3600,"comment_status":"closed","ping_status":"closed","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":[],"categories":[26],"tags":[],"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/1890"}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/post"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/3"}],"replies":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/comments?post=1890"}],"version-history":[{"count":8,"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/1890\/revisions"}],"predecessor-version":[{"id":3602,"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/1890\/revisions\/3602"}],"wp:featuredmedia":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media\/3600"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=1890"}],"wp:term":[{"taxonomy":"category","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/categories?post=1890"},{"taxonomy":"post_tag","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/eurodez.uz\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/tags?post=1890"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
